The Live Streaming Intern typically assists with live broadcasts, focusing on technical setup and support during events. In contrast, a Content Producer manages the overall content strategy, pre-production, and editing. While both roles involve media and digital platforms, the intern role is more entry-level and hands-on during live events, whereas the producer role involves planning and content management throughout the production process.
